Output 23e318213e8fc80e61d640e17fdf2a2e6d7f87777f4d9f31fce9a15e216c2c19:0

value
281720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c92846b953c9ab100e279e30f8e969d5456760 OP_EQUAL
address
3KB5xqejrm33ydHNPJHshm9PaP7JJyFVV4
transaction
23e318213e8fc80e61d640e17fdf2a2e6d7f87777f4d9f31fce9a15e216c2c19
confirmations
347115
spent
true